New President takes charge

The first Council meeting of 2010 took place on 15 January, when Norman Train, pictured above, was inaugurated as the 90th President of the Institution by outgoing President, Graham Owens.rnAs a result of the presentation to the October Council meeting by CIC Chairman, Keith Clarke, urging the Institution to take a proactive role with Government over climate change, letters were sent to the UK, Australia and Canada governments emphasising the role of structural engineers (prior to the Copehangen conference), and a brief guide to embodied carbon measurement is being prepared. Council members welcomed the action, but wanted to see more. Sarah Fray, Director Engineering and Technical Services, agreed that the Institution was following the agenda rather than providing leadership at the moment, but hoped to change that.
